MAKE-BEFORE-BREAK (MBB) HANDOVER OPERATIONS

    Abstract: Aspects of the present disclosure relate to wireless communications, and more particularly, to performing a handover on a per-data radio bearer (DRB) basis. In some examples, the disclosure is directed to indicating, to a source network entity, a make-before-break (MBB) handover capability of the UE, the MBB handover capability supporting MBB handovers for one or more DRBs identified by the source network entity. In some examples, the disclosure describes receiving, from the source network entity, configuration information for a handover from the source network entity to a target network entity, the configuration information identifying the one or more DRBs supported for the MBB handover.

    Abstract: Various aspects of the present disclosure generally relate to wireless communication. In some aspects, a user equipment (UE) may determine a prioritization rule that indicates a relative priority for different uplink communications included in a group of uplink communications, wherein the group of uplink communications includes at least a first uplink communication and a second uplink communication to be transmitted by the UE using time-division multiplexing during a make-before-break handover procedure. The UE may transmit, based at least in part on the prioritization rule, the first uplink communication to a target base station and the second uplink communication to a source base station using time-division multiplexing during the make-before-break handover procedure.     Abstract: Techniques and apparatuses described herein provide for an indication that a unified access control (UAC) parameter of a user equipment (UE) has changed. For example, a paging message or direct indication information may be provided to a UE indicating that a UAC parameter has changed. In such a case, the UE may not be expected to periodically check a scheduling information list of a system information block type 1 (SIB1). Thus, battery power of UEs may be conserved and signaling resources that would otherwise be used to periodically check the scheduling information list may be conserved.

    RADIO LINK CONTROL ACKNOWLEDGEMENT MODE TIMING FOR MULTI MODAL TRAFFIC

    Abstract: Methods, systems, and devices for wireless communications are described. A network may configure one or more devices with a timer. The timer may define a threshold amount of time a receiver in a radio link control (RLC) acknowledgement mode (AM) is to wait for and continue to request retransmission of a missing RLC packet data unit (PDU) through automatic repeat request (ARQ) mechanisms. The receiver may detect a missing PDU, and may initiate two timers: a first timer defining how long the receiver is to request and monitor for the missing first PDU, and a second timer defining an amount of time before requesting retransmission of the first PDU. Upon expiration of the second timer, the receiver may transmit a request for retransmission of the first PDU. Upon expiration of the first timer, the receiver may forward all other sequentially received PDUs to higher layers for decoding.

    NEW RADIO SYNCHRONIZATION SIGNAL BLOCK RELATED IDLE MEASUREMENT CONFIGURATION

    Abstract: Methods, systems, and devices for wireless communications are described. A user equipment (UE) may receive synchronization signal block (SSB) related measurement configurations exclusively in a system information block (SIB). The UE may receive SSB frequency lists for idle measurements in both a SIB or a radio resource control (RRC) message, such as an RRC release message. In some examples, the UE may receive SSB related measurement configurations or SSB frequency lists for idle measurements in a SIB and an RRC message. Additionally or alternatively, the UE may receive SSB frequency lists in a SIB and an RRC message, while SSB measurement configurations for SSB frequencies out of a sync raster may exclusively be indicated in the RRC message. The UE may therefore experience improved coverage and reliability and, in some examples, may promote low latency for wireless communications relating to multiple radio access technologies, among other benefits.

    RADIO ACCESS NETWORK SHARING USING A TRANSPORT PROXY FUNCTION

    Abstract: Methods, systems, and devices for wireless communications are described. An access and mobility management function (AMF) proxy may establish a first communication link between a radio access network (RAN) of a first network operator and a first AMF of the first network operator via the AMF proxy and a second communication link between the RAN of the first network operator and a second AMF of a second network operator via the AMF proxy. The AMF proxy may receive a message from the RAN via the first communication link or the second communication link directed towards a target proxy endpoint address of the first AMF or of the second AMF. As such, the AMF proxy may transmit the message from the RAN to the first or to the second AMF based on a mapping between a set of target proxy endpoint addresses, and one or more source proxy endpoint addresses.
